Melon, mint and ginger cooler

  • Hands-on time: 10 mins
  • Time to make: 20 mins
  • Serving: 6 people

Ingredients

  • about 1.25cm fresh ginger, finely grated
    • 2 limes, zest and juice
    • 1 vanilla pod, seeds scraped out
    • 1 cup water
    • ¼ cup sugar
    • 1 tablespoon liquid honey
    • 1 small rockmelon, flesh cut in small cubes
    • 1 small honeydew melon, flesh cut in small cubes
    • 1 mango, flesh cut in cubes
    • ⅓ cup sliced fresh mint
    • 8-10 ice cubes

    1 Place ginger, lime zest and juice, vanilla seeds and pod, water, sugar and honey in a pot and boil for 8-10 minutes or until syrupy.

    2 Leave syrup to cool then mix in melons, mango, mint and ice cubes.

    3 Divide among glasses and serve chilled.
